Sweden population 2021 During 2021 Sweden population is projected to increase by 84,156 people and reach 10,235,622 in the beginning of 2022. The natural increase is expected to be positive, as the number of births will exceed the number of deaths by 26,394. Population Distributed by Age. Life expectancy in Sweden was 84.7 years for women and 81.3 years for men in 2019. Sweden is to some extent facing the same problem as most of Europe with an ageing population, although the birth rate is fairly high compared to many other countries.

The total resident population of Sweden was 10,377,781 in October 2020. The population exceeded 10 million for the first time on Friday, 20 January 2017. [2] [3] The three largest cities are Stockholm , Gothenburg and Malmö .

According to current projections, Sweden ’s population is expected to continue growing through the rest of the century. As of 2020, the population is 10.1 million people and is projected to be 11.39 million by 2050 and 12.95 million by 2099.
